State Government Orders All Departments to Vacate Private Buildings by December 31

The State Government has ordered all departments and affiliated offices to leave private buildings and move into government-owned spaces by December 31. No rental payments for private office spaces will be made from February 1. The move aims to save costs by using vacant government office spaces once occupied by Andhra Pradesh.

UK Supermarkets Bring in European Turkeys Amid Avian Flu Toll

UK supermarkets like Asda, Lidl, and Morrisons have started importing turkeys from Europe due to avian flu hitting local supplies. While British turkeys make up most sales, imported birds fill gaps to keep shelves stocked for Christmas.

IMD Warns Cold Wave in 11 Telangana Districts; Sangareddy Hits 5.3°C

The India Meteorological Department has warned of a cold wave in 11 Telangana districts on December 22. Temperatures have already dropped below 10°C in many places, with Sangareddy recording the lowest at 5.3°C. Hyderabad will have clear skies but cold foggy mornings are expected.
